EKG Technician

10 Weeks        60 Hours        Dates and Times TBA

Completers of the EKG Technician Course can learn to operate equipment used in hospitals, clinics, and doctor's offices.  Previous health field experience is recommended.  Students will sit for the National Certification Exam through ASPT.

Refrigerant Transition and Recovery Certification for HVACR Technicians

EPA Approved        Dates and Times TBA

This program assumes that participants have prior refrigeration and air-conditioning system competency, which is necessary for effective recovery of refrigerant.  System competency is tested in four parts.  All test include 25 questions of a core section covering environmental impact of CFC's and HCFCS, laws and regulations, and changing industry outlook.  There are 25 questions each in the following certification areas:

  • Type I: Small Appliance

  • Type II: High Pressure Very High Pressure

  • Type III: Low Pressure

Universal certification is granted upon successful completion of the core, Type I, Type II, and Type III (100 total questions).  The core section is a prerequisite to any certification.

State Tested Nurse's Assistant

 96 Hours        Times TBA        Fall and Spring Classes Offered

Nurse Assistants work in nursing homes, home health settings, hospitals, clinics, and doctors' offices.  Graduates are qualified to take the CPR Test and the State Nursing Assistant Test for certification.
